Steven Nelson is one of the best remaining cornerbacks on the free agent market, and he could sign with a longtime division rival.

Steven Nelson, a former Houston Texans cornerback, is one of the most undervalued players on the free agent market. While the former third-round pick has never been a superstar, Nelson has been a consistent starter throughout his career. Despite being on the wrong side of 30, the defensive back concluded the 2023 season with four interceptions, 12 passes defended, 63 tackles, and a 72.6 PFF grade, ranking 29th out of 127 qualified players.

C.J. Stroud was the primary driving force behind Houston’s unexpected postseason run last year, but Nelson helped shore up the secondary as a dependable CB2 opposite Derek Stingley. Steven Nelson, now a free agent, will most likely leave Houston to join another team. The Jacksonville Jaguars are the greatest fit, according to Bleacher Report, despite potential interest from other organizations.

Overall, the depth at cornerback is a worry. They will get help in the slot from the safeties, although Ronald Darby has previously suffered ailments, and Tyson Campbell missed six games last season. Steven Nelson is one of the most dependable cornerbacks left, and the Jaguars should be familiar with him from his stint with the Houston Texans in the AFC South.

Jaguars Could Sign Free Agent Steven Nelson

Following a breakout 2022, Trevor Lawrence and the Jacksonville Jaguars were expected to dominate the AFC South for years. However, Stroud’s breakout resulted in an unexpected postseason absence, highlighting how Jacksonville sorely has to upgrade its squad to compete with a great Texans club. As previously stated, Jacksonville’s secondary could use some improvement, and Steven Nelson might be the most realistic free agency option available.

Steven Nelson is unlikely to sign until Stephon Gilmore finds a new home as a free agent. The former Defensive Player of the Year is unquestionably the greatest cornerback on the market today, and he should be the first choice for any team searching for help at the position. Once Gilmore is eliminated, clubs should look to Nelson as a reliable consolation prize. If the Jaguars cannot sign him, one of these other teams should.
